Repurchase of Ordinary Shares Sample Clauses

Repurchase of Ordinary Shares. Notwithstanding any other provision of this Section 6, subject to the Statute, the Company may at any time, out of funds legally available therefor, repurchase Ordinary Shares of the Company issued to or held by employees, officers, directors, contractors, advisors or consultants of any one of the Group Companies upon termination of their employment or services, pursuant to any bona fide agreement providing for such right of repurchase, whether or not dividends on the Preferred Shares shall have been declared.

Repurchase of Ordinary Shares. 7.1 Subject to the provisions of the Statute and the Memorandum, the Company may at any time and from time to time purchase the Company's issued Ordinary Shares by (i) agreement between the Company and any one or more of its Shareholders holding the Ordinary Shares to be purchased, (ii) tender offer to all Shareholders or (iii) purchase on any exchange or market on which the Ordinary Shares are traded, provided always that, in each case, unless approved by Ordinary Resolution, the purchase price is no greater than the then existing market price as determined by the Directors by reference to the closing prices on the principal exchange or market for the Ordinary Shares for a period of not less than one and not more than ten consecutive trading days ending not more than three trading days before such determination. In the event of a purchase by the Company of its own Ordinary Shares on any exchange or market on which the Ordinary Shares are traded, the manner of the purchase shall be in accordance with the rules and regulations of the relevant exchange or market.

  • Listing of Ordinary Shares The Company hereby agrees to use best efforts to maintain the listing or quotation of the Ordinary Shares on the Trading Market on which it is currently listed, and concurrently with the Closing, the Company shall apply to list or quote all of the Shares and Warrant Shares on such Trading Market and promptly secure the listing of all of the Shares and Warrant Shares on such Trading Market. The Company further agrees, if the Company applies to have the Ordinary Shares traded on any other Trading Market, it will then include in such application all of the Shares and Warrant Shares, and will take such other action as is necessary to cause all of the Shares and Warrant Shares to be listed or quoted on such other Trading Market as promptly as possible. The Company will then take all action reasonably necessary to continue the listing and trading of its Ordinary Shares on a Trading Market and will comply in all respects with the Company’s reporting, filing and other obligations under the bylaws or rules of the Trading Market. The Company agrees to maintain the eligibility of the Ordinary Shares for electronic transfer through the Depository Trust Company or another established clearing corporation, including, without limitation, by timely payment of fees to the Depository Trust Company or such other established clearing corporation in connection with such electronic transfer.
